Why isn’t this considered a “blue wave” again? Simply because the Dems didn’t win control of the Senate? Weird, because I’m looking at a party that (as of this writing):
- Won 21 of 30 available Senate seats
- Won 220 of 419 available House seats and gained control of that chamber
- Made deep gains in many statehouses across the country, gaining full control in multiple states
- Saw many progressive amendments/propositions pass
- Won almost 57% of the vote in Senate races
- Won over 51% of the vote in House races
- Elected the most diverse set of candidates in the history of our country
The loss of Senate seats was strictly a fluky map issue. This was a blue wave by almost every criteria, and a clear rebuke to the President and his party.
